Land in Puhuka Hamlet, Canterbury Land District, open
for Selection on Lease in Perpetuity.
District Lands and Survey Office,
Christchurch, 16th May, 1905.
NOTICE is hereby given that the undermentioned land
will be open for selection on lease in perpetuity, at
this office, on Wednesday, the 5th day of July, 1905,
under the provisions of “The Land for Settlements Con-
solidation Act, 1900,” and amendments.
If more than one application is received for the section
on the same day, the order of selection shall be decided
by ballot.
SCHEDULE.
Canterbury Land District.—Puhuka Hamlet.
Workman’s Home.

Weighted with £28, valuation for improvements, consist-
ing of small wooden cottage, 12ft. by 10ft., iron roof,
match-lined, no chimney; well and windlass; and fencing
on the east, north, and west boundaries.
This section is situated on the south side of the Puhuka
Road at Washdyke, about two miles and three-quarters
north of the centre of Timaru and three-quarters of a mile
from the Smithfield Freezing-works. It comprises open
land, sloping from both the north and south ends to a ridge
in the middle, the elevation ranging from 15 ft. to 50 ft.
above sea-level. The soil is of good quality, on clay subsoil.
THOS. HUMPHRIES,
Commissioner of Crown Lands.
Pastoral Run in Canterbury Land District for Lease by
Public Auction.
District Lands and Survey Office,
Christchurch, 17th May, 1905.
NOTICE is hereby given that the undermentioned pas-
toral run will be offered for lease by public auction
at the Land Office, Timaru, at 11 a.m. on Wednesday, the
28th day of June, 1905, for the term and at the upset
annual rental stated, under the provisions of Part VI. of
“The Land Act, 1892.”
In the event of the run not being disposed of at auction it
will immediately thereafter be open for lease on application
at this office and the Land Office, Timaru.
SCHEDULE.
Canterbury Land District.—Waimate County.
RUN No. 44, Bluecliffs (Class I.): Area, 17,000 acres ;
upset annual rental, £200. Term of lease, twelve years.
This run is situated on the western slopes of the Hunters
Hills, between the summit and the River Waihao, about
twenty-three miles distant from St. Andrew’s Railway-
station, at an altitude of from 2,000 ft. to 5,000 ft. above sea-
level. It comprises high spurs, falling steeply into the
creeks, but becoming less rugged as they approach the
Waihao River, mostly covered with tussock, snow-grass, and
other native grasses. The run is weighted with a sum of
£200 as valuation for improvements: this comprises the half
value of about thirteen miles of boundary fence, full value of
about three miles and a quarter of fencing which lies entirely
within the run although used as a boundary fence, full value
of nearly three miles of subdivisional fencing, and two huts,
each 12 ft. by 12 ft., built of wood and roofed with iron. The
amount of this valuation must be paid to the Receiver of
Land Revenue, Christchurch, before possession is given.
THOS. HUMPHRIES,
Commissioner of Crown Lands.
